Study Suggests Minnesota is One of the Top Ten States for Millennials

(KNSI) – An analysis by WalletHub suggests that Minnesota is the sixth-best state in the nation for Millennials.

The generation of adults who were born between 1981 and 1996 fare best in Washinton, the District of Columbia and Utah; those are the study’s top three states overall.

Minnesota ranks fourth-best for the percentage of Millennials who are insured. The state also has the fourth-lowest unemployment rate and fourth-highest homeownership rate among that generation.

The average monthly earnings for Millenials in Minnesota ranks 12th among all 50 states and D.C.
